Output 521ca20db3b486570015b61ab06bcc3076e9aa8fcb16d66c3fd8cba0a0fc9c9d:1

value
8892246
script pubkey
OP_0 OP_PUSHBYTES_20 fdc4d31f044893bc893f0dfadb83d465b9ec442e
address
bc1qlhzdx8cyfzfmezflphadhq75vku7c3pw8zdfa8
transaction
521ca20db3b486570015b61ab06bcc3076e9aa8fcb16d66c3fd8cba0a0fc9c9d
confirmations
295937
spent
true